Understanding the Pricing Trends of Acrylonitrile Butadiene Rubber (NBR)
Acrylonitrile butadiene rubber (NBR) is a key synthetic rubber that has garnered significant attention in various industries, especially automotive, aerospace, and consumer goods, due to its excellent resistance to oil, fuel, and other chemicals. As global demand for durable and climate-resistant materials continues to rise, monitoring the price trends of NBR becomes increasingly crucial for manufacturers and consumers alike.

Moreover, the supply-demand dynamics play a pivotal role in determining NBR prices. Increased demand for NBR in industries such as automotive for tire manufacturing, as well as in oil and gas for seals and hoses, has placed upward pressure on prices. On the other hand, overproduction or a downturn in specific markets can lead to surplus supply, which often results in price reductions. Therefore, manufacturers must continuously evaluate market conditions and adjust their production strategies accordingly.
Additionally, geopolitical factors can also influence NBR prices. Events such as trade sanctions, production outages due to natural disasters, and political instability in oil-producing regions can all lead to significant shifts in market availability. For example, any disruptions in the supply chain of raw materials can cause a spike in NBR prices, driving manufacturers to seek alternative sourcing or materials to maintain cost-effectiveness.
Furthermore, technological advancements and innovation in production processes may also impact NBR pricing. Manufacturers that invest in new technologies can enhance their production efficiency, reduce waste, and ultimately lower costs. As more sustainable and environmentally-friendly manufacturing practices are adopted, the effects on pricing become evident, as consumers increasingly prefer products that not only meet their performance needs but also align with their values regarding sustainability.
The current landscape for NBR pricing also reflects broader economic trends. Inflationary pressures, changing trade policies, and shifts toward greener alternatives in manufacturing are shaping the rubber market. End-users are now considering not just the cost of NBR but also the long-term sustainability and ethical implications of sourcing materials.
In conclusion, the pricing of acrylonitrile butadiene rubber is a multifaceted issue that encompasses global economics, supply chain dynamics, and technological advancements. Stakeholders must remain vigilant in monitoring these trends to make informed decisions regarding production, purchasing, and investment. As the market continues to evolve, understanding the factors influencing NBR pricing will be essential for navigating the complexities of this vital material in the 21st century.
